Monday Night Football Preview: Lions face uphill battle to get into the win column in Seattle

The fans at CenturyLink Field will be treated to a game between the Detroit Lions and the Seattle Seahawks when they take their seats on Monday.

Oddsmakers currently have the Seahawks listed as 10½-point favorites versus the Lions, while the game’s total is sitting at 43½.

Detroit was a 24-12 loser in its last match at home against the Broncos. They failed to cover the +3-point spread as underdogs, while the total score of 36 sent UNDER bettors to the payout window.

Detroit:
Team record: 0-3 SU,0-3 ATS
Current Streak: lost 3 straight games.
Detroit is 1-6 ATS in its last 7 games
Detroit is 0-5 SU in its last 5 games
The total has gone UNDER in 17 of Detroit’s last 23 games
Detroit is 1-7 ATS in its last 8 games on the road

Seattle:
Team record: 1-2 SU,1-2 ATS
Seattle is 1-4-1 ATS in its last 6 games
Seattle is 9-3 SU in its last 12 games
The total has gone OVER in 4 of Seattle’s last 6 games
Seattle is 8-1 SU in its last 9 games at home
